Béla Ágai is a scholar working on Organic Chemistry, Spectroscopy and Bioengineering. According to data from OpenAlex, Béla Ágai has authored 40 papers receiving a total of 623 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Organic Chemistry, 15 papers in Spectroscopy and 13 papers in Bioengineering. Recurrent topics in Béla Ágai’s work include Analytical Chemistry and Sensors (13 papers), Molecular Sensors and Ion Detection (13 papers) and Synthesis of heterocyclic compounds (6 papers). Béla Ágai is often cited by papers focused on Analytical Chemistry and Sensors (13 papers), Molecular Sensors and Ion Detection (13 papers) and Synthesis of heterocyclic compounds (6 papers). Béla Ágai collaborates with scholars based in Hungary and France. Béla Ágai's co-authors include Károly Lempert, István Bitter, Klára Tóth, Lásʐló Tőke, Alajos Grűn, Sándor Békássy, Ernö Lindner, Judit Jeney, F. Figuéras and Ágnes Proszenyák and has published in prestigious journals such as Tetrahedron, Applied Catalysis A General and Tetrahedron Letters.
